The Power of Storytelling: Unlocking the Essence of Communication

Storytelling is an age-old practice that transcends cultural boundaries and has been a fundamental part of human civilization since its inception. At its core, storytelling is the art of conveying a message or a series of events through a narrative. It involves the use of words, images, gestures, and emotions to captivate an audience and immerse them in a vivid and engaging experience. Storytelling can take various forms, including verbal tales passed down through generations, written literature, visual media such as films and animations, and even interactive digital platforms. It is a timeless and universal means of communication that has the power to entertain, inspire, educate, and influence.




Objectives and Benefits of Storytelling

The primary objective of storytelling is to connect with others on a deep and emotional level. By crafting narratives that resonate with the human experience, storytellers aim to foster empathy, spark imagination, and establish a profound connection with their audience. Through storytelling, complex ideas can be simplified and made relatable, making it easier for individuals to understand and internalize information. Moreover, storytelling serves as a powerful tool for conveying values, cultural traditions, and moral lessons, allowing societies to preserve their heritage and pass it on to future generations.

The benefits of storytelling are vast and extend beyond mere entertainment. Stories have the ability to inspire change, shape perceptions, and influence behavior. They evoke emotions, engage the senses, and create memorable experiences that leave a lasting impact. By engaging both the rational and emotional faculties of the human mind, storytelling can be a persuasive force for conveying messages, whether it be promoting social causes, fostering brand loyalty, or driving sales. Additionally, storytelling has been proven to enhance learning and retention by making information more accessible, relatable, and memorable. It is through stories that we can communicate complex concepts and ideas in a compelling and digestible manner.

The Importance of Storytelling for Building a Brand

In today's competitive business landscape, where consumers are inundated with an overwhelming amount of information, storytelling has become an indispensable tool for businesses to differentiate themselves and build a strong brand. A well-crafted brand story can create a unique identity, establish an emotional connection with customers, and foster brand loyalty. By sharing the journey, values, and vision behind their products or services, businesses can humanize their brand and make it more relatable to their target audience.

Storytelling allows businesses to showcase their authenticity, values, and purpose. It enables them to engage customers on a deeper level by appealing to their emotions and aspirations. A compelling brand story can evoke positive emotions and associations, which in turn can influence consumer behavior, encourage brand advocacy, and drive customer loyalty. Moreover, storytelling helps businesses to differentiate themselves from their competitors, as it is the narrative and emotional resonance that sets them apart, rather than just the features or benefits of their offerings.
